Output f6590fcb88d5c0653c3b8ce64eeb8b6ca05ea6a805c982260a04f368cbcc42f9:9

value
155893474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3624121d860394ea0a59078df4bd467043cf5397 OP_EQUAL
address
MCqRw2fmDcU88dsDRuqaj1XEcXaKxAgSVe
transaction
f6590fcb88d5c0653c3b8ce64eeb8b6ca05ea6a805c982260a04f368cbcc42f9
spent
true